Biography
Dr. Deb Plate is a Clinical Associate Director at the Center for Family Medicine where she trains future family physicians. She is the Family Medicine Undergraduate Site Director coordinating and challenging all students that come through the Center inspiring many to choose family medicine as their specialty.
Dr. Plate completed her undergraduate degree at the University of Toledo. She earned her medical degree at the Ohio University Heritage College of Osteopathic Medicine where she was selected to complete a pre-doctoral family medicine fellowship that included a 5th year of research, teaching and running a rural clinic in return for tuition support. Dr. Plate completed her residency training at Cleveland Clinic Akron General in Family Medicine. She served as chief resident during her third year of residency and was in private practice for 11 years before returning to the place where it all began for her at the Center for Family Medicine Residency program. She is board certified and has earned Fellow status through the American Academy of Family Physicians.
Dr. Plate was named Ohio Academy Physician of the Year Award in 2008. “Be the exception” and “Because nice matters” are words displayed in her office that she lives by day to day.
She was a familiar voice on the radio locally as she promoted safety and wellness over the air waves on weekly on WAKR for 11 years and continues to serve on many community forums educating the public on various health concerns. Her passion for serving the underserved is best defined by her long term involvement at the ACCESS, Inc. homeless shelter and clinic where she now serves as a board member.
As Chair of the Department of Family Medicine, she is dedicated to promoting family medicine as an important specialty to improve the health and lives of the communities and patients we serve.
Dr Plate is married and has two grown children and one grandchild.
